Competitive Landscape
Top Players Sustain Lead Amid Moderately Competitive Landscape
The sunglasses market in Romania remained moderately concentrated in 2026, with Safilo Group SpA leading with a share of 19%, followed by Luxottica Group SpA with 10%, while other players, such as Donna Karan International Inc, Dolce & Gabbana Srl, De Rigo SpA, and FF Group Romania Srl, held smaller shares.
Private Label Growth Creates Opportunities for Value-Driven Consumer Segments
A significant development in the Romanian sunglasses landscape is the expansion of private label offerings, which serve as accessible options for income-restrained consumers seeking fashionable yet affordable products. This trend has contributed to a more diverse competitive environment by capturing demand from price-sensitive shoppers without diluting the appeal of premium brands.

Sunglasses
Sunglasses may be made with either prescription or non-prescription lenses that are darken to provide protection against bright light and possibly ultraviolet (UV) light. Photo-chromic lenses and clip-ons are excluded.
